Elder Dragon-Level Monsters (Japanese 古龍級生物) are monsters that can bring major damage to ecosystems or monsters that are comparable in strength to Elder Dragons. There are two different types of Elder Dragon-Level Monsters, Elder Dragon Influenced Monsters and Elder Dragon Strength Monsters.

Ravientecloud

What Are Elder Dragon Influenced Monsters?[]

Elder Dragon Influenced Monsters (Japanese 古龍並の影響力) are monsters that were influenced in some way by the abilities of an Elder Dragon, such as Shagaru Magala/Risen Shagaru Magala, Gaismagorm, Wind Serpent Ibushi, or Thunder Serpent Narwa/Narwa the Allmother.

What Are Elder Dragon Strength Monsters?[]

Elder Dragon Strength Monsters (Japanese 古龍並の戦闘力) are monsters with the strength and power to rival Elder Dragons or even be considered equal to Elder Dragons.

Reasoning For Them Being Elder Dragon-Level Monsters[]

Rare Species[]

Rare Species are about as rare as Elder Dragons. Some Rare Species even have some abilities that are on par with Elder Dragons. It has even been found that some Rare Species use the Dragon Element like Elder Dragons, though isn't really noticeable most of the time. Notably Silver Rathalos and Gold Rathian have been observed taking down Bazelgeuse and Kushala Daora respectively with ease.

Frenzy Apex Monsters[]

Frenzy Apex Monsters are said to be on par with a Frenzied Deviljho. They can destroy ecosystems, infect areas with the Frenzy Virus, and even destroy settlements. This puts them as Elder Dragon-Level Monsters.

Deviants[]

Deviants are an extremely dangerous type of monster whose strength can reach that of Elder Dragons. While weaker Deviants such as Snowbaron Lagombi and Redhelm Arzuros don't quite reach the same level of threat as Elder Dragons, some Deviants easily rival Elder Dragons. Deviants like Hellblade Glavenus can actually bring destruction to whole mountains easily or burn said areas in an instant like Dreadking Rathalos, while Bloodbath Diablos is infamous for slaughtering entire armies. The known Deviants that can be considered as Elder Dragon-Level Monster include Hellblade Glavenus, Dreadking Rathalos, Dreadqueen Rathian, Silverwind Nargacuga, Grimclaw Tigrex, Crystalbeard Uragaan, Thunderlord Zinogre, Deadeye Yian Garuga, Elderfrost Gammoth, Boltreaver Astalos, Soulseer Mizutsune, and Bloodbath Diablos.

Tempered Monsters[]

Tempered Monsters are creatures that have absorbed bioenergy that runs within the New World due to the Elder Crossing. As the source of bioenergy originate from actual Elder Dragons that have passed away, the Guild monitors every creature that can reach the Tempered State. Though some monsters may not reach the same level as that of an Elder Dragon, certain monsters such as the Black Diablos are known to be on par to that of an Elder Dragon when the monster becomes Tempered to the point that even a Deviljho would steer clear from the presence of such a Tempered Monster.

Akantor[]

Akantor's overwhelming strength and the fact that it was temporarily classified as an Elder Dragon, makes it an Elder Dragon-Level Monster. It has been seen surviving in heavy thunderstorms and long droughts, before bringing destruction to whole towns. When it appears, the public is evacuated from an area since it can bring on tremendous destruction like an Elder Dragon.

Rajang and Furious Rajang[]

In legend, Rajang was called an Elder Dragon. Despite being a Fanged Beast, it is stated that its power is equal to that of an Elder Dragon and that Furious Rajang are truly powerful enough to take on Elder Dragons, such as Kushala Daora. Rajang are also put into this group due to the Elder Dragon Kirin being their prey.

Shen Gaoren[]

From Shen Gaoren constantly looking for and destroying things that disturb their territory, such as towns, cities, and barriers, it is considered an Elder Dragon-Level Monster. It's massive size also warrants this.

Ukanlos[]

Ukanlos was classified as an Elder Dragon, temporarily, after it was discovered. It was feared that it would eventually bring destruction to numbers of areas due to its size and bulk. It is considered to be equal to Akantor in power and about as aggressive. Even when just being discovered carelessly, or living close to a village, some Ukanlos will attack settlements immediately without warning. This puts them at a level equal to Elder Dragons.

Deviljho and Savage Deviljho[]

A Deviljho's gluttonous behavior puts it on a level with Elder Dragons. It can make all nearby species in an area go extinct, including large predatory monsters, which it has been observed killing and eating. Deviljho has also been seen attacking Rajang and Elder Dragons, standing its ground instead of fleeing when these monsters appear.

Gore Magala and Chaotic Gore Magala[]

Due to Gore Magala being the juvenile form of Shagaru Magala, it is considered an Elder Dragon-Level Monster. Though Gore Magala's power isn't comparable to its adult form yet, it is still able to spread the Frenzy Virus. Chaotic Gore Magala is traumatized from improperly molting, thus having the abilities of Shagaru Magala with much stronger and less controlled Frenzy Virus attacks and physical strength.

Raging Brachydios[]

Raging Brachydios wields an intensely volatile slime and is much larger than regular Brachydios, adding further power to its devastating blows. This is especially evident in the New World, as Raging Brachydios is capable of immense explosive power that reshapes the landscape and renders capture (and escape) impossible.

Ahtal-Ka[]

Though Ahtal-Ka is small in size, it is considered an Elder Dragon-Level Monster due to its tendency to raid and destroy heavily-armed fortresses. This is enough to compare it to Elder Dragons like Gogmazios. Ahtal-Ka is also able to use its webbing to manipulate a massive, dragon-like structure known as the Ahtal-Neset, which it has created using materials from destroyed fortresses.

Bazelgeuse and Seething Bazelgeuse[]

Bazelgeuse is able to withstand attacks from Deviljho and even fight back against it. It is considered a rival to Deviljho, with the two species keeping each other's populations in check in the New World. This alone is enough to put it on a level equal with Elder Dragons. Seething Bazelgeuse can similarly take on Savage Deviljho, a monster infamous for engaging in intense fights with Elder Dragons. Bazelgeuse is also able to temporarily hold its own and put up a fight against Ruiner Nergigante, despite the latter being a powerful Elder Dragon. Seething Bazelgeuse in particular has explosive capabilities on par with some elder dragons such as Teostra, being able to consume entire areas in explosions by scattering their purple scales.

Magnamalo and Scorned Magnamalo[]

Magnamalo is powerful enough to have nearly decimated Kamura Village 50 years ago. The main reason is due to it feasting on the numerous monsters that appear during the annual Rampage, increasing its strength to the point where it can destroy villages. Because of this, Magnamalo is considered to be on par with Elder Dragons in terms of destructive might. As well as this, it often attacks more powerful Elder Dragons like Teostra and Kushala Daora, being able to beat down both Elder Dragons within their respective Turf Wars despite getting equally injured in the process. It also brave enough to face the Source of the Rampage; Narwa the Allmother. Its Variant, Scorned Magnamalo, is also fierce and powerful enough to face off against the equally feared Malzeno and Velkhana.

Apex Monsters (Rise)[]

Apex Monsters have destructive powers similar to that of a Deviant, and are powerful enough to cause great destruction to Kamura Village and control Monsters during the Rampage quests. They are on par with Elder Dragons. Apex Zinogre can hold its own against Amatsu.

Afflicted Monsters[]

Afflicted Monsters possesses dangerous destructive powers when influenced by the Qurio. Like Malzeno, they can drain lifeforce of anything that gets in their way. Despite the fact that they will inevitably die due to being incompatible hosts for the Qurio, their increased power and erratic behavior makes Afflicted Monsters a huge threat to the ecosystem and all forms of life.

Espinas Species[]

Despite its usually calm demeanor, an angered Espinas' sheer power is enough to rival that of Elder Dragons. An Espinas that lived within the Great Forest was able to fight and defeat an unspecified Elder Dragon during ancient times, as well as defeat a Kushala Daora in Monster Hunter Online[1]. In Monster Hunter Rise: Sunbreak, Espinas has a turf war with Kushala Daora and manages to hold its own against the Elder Dragon. The Zenith Espinas, Flaming Espinas and Espinas Rare Species are capable of this as well. Flaming Espinas can potentially outmatch both the flying prowess and flame intensity of a Teostra.

Berukyurosu and Doragyurosu[]

Due to Berukyurosu's high intelligence and fighting abilities in the sky, it is considered to be an Elder Dragon-Level Monster. The same also applies for Doragyurosu and Zenith Doragyurosu.

Odibatorasu[]

Like Akantor and Ukanlos, Odibatorasu is about equal to Elder Dragons. Unlike its relatives, however, it is known to prey upon not only monsters but also buildings and even rocks surrounding areas. Odibatorasu can even cause large sandstorms just with its breath. The destruction it can cause, such as destroying settlements and ecosystems, is enough to compare to it an Elder Dragon.

Laviente[]

Although Laviente's classification is unknown, it is also known that it can destroy a whole island simply by moving from place to place in search of food. This alone is enough to place it on the same level as Elder Dragons. The same applies to Violent Laviente and Berserk Laviente.

Unknown (Black Flying Wyvern)[]

From the recent discovery of the Unknown (Black Flying Wyvern) in the Tower, it is said that it is perfectly capable of raining hellfire on villages and towns easily. This is enough to put it alongside Elder Dragons.

Estrellian Species[]

From Estrellian being seen with multiple natural disasters and being the juvenile form of an unidentified Elder Dragon, it is considered an Elder Dragon-Level Monster.
